What is Congenital Cataract?
A congenital cataract is a clouding of the eye’s natural lens that is present at birth.
Depending on the density and location of the opacity, a congenital cataract may need to be removed surgically while the child is still an infant, to allow vision to develop normally and to prevent amblyopia or even blindness.
Some congenital cataracts, however, affect only a small part of the lens and do not interfere with vision enough to justify surgery.
How common is congenital cataract?
- In the United Kingdom, the incidence of congenital cataracts affecting vision has been estimated at 2.49 per 10,000 population by the age of 1 year
- Because some cases are diagnosed late, the incidence rises to 3.46 per 10,000 population by the age of 15 — equivalent to 200-300 children born with a congenital cataract in the UK each year.
What causes congenital cataracts?

Congenital cataracts can occur in newborn babies for many reasons, including hereditary diseases, infections, metabolic disorders, diabetes, trauma, inflammation or the side effects of medication.
For example, tetracycline antibiotics used to treat infections in pregnant women have been shown to cause cataracts in newborn babies.
Congenital cataracts can also develop when the mother contracts an infection during pregnancy, such as measles or rubella (the most common cause), chickenpox, cytomegalovirus, herpes simplex, herpes zoster, polio, influenza, Epstein-Barr virus, syphilis or toxoplasmosis.
Older babies and children can also be diagnosed with cataracts, known as paediatric cataracts, for similar reasons. However, trauma such as a blow to the eye is the underlying cause in 40 per cent of cataract cases in older children.
Some paediatric cataracts may in fact be congenital cataracts that simply went undetected because the child did not have their first eye examination until later in childhood.
Types of congenital cataracts
The main types of congenital cataract are:
- Anterior polar cataracts are well defined and located at the front of the lens. They are often associated with hereditary traits, and many are small and do not require surgery.
- Posterior polar cataracts are also well-defined opacities, but they appear at the back of the lens.
- Nuclear cataracts occur in the central part of the lens and are a very common form of congenital cataract.
- Cerulean cataracts (blue-dot cataracts) usually occur in both of an infant’s eyes and are distinguished by small, bluish dots in the lens. Typically, this type of cataract does not cause vision problems.
What are the symptoms of congenital cataracts?

An infant with mild cataracts often appears to have no symptoms at all, which can delay the diagnosis for years.
In other cases, a white reflection in the pupil, a lack of response to light, strabismus, an inability to follow toys and faces, or an apparent delay in development raise concern. Mild cataracts may cause photophobia only in bright light, while dense cataracts may come to light when they lead to the development of sensory nystagmus.
When does my child need cataract surgery?
Opinions vary as to when surgery should be performed on a child with congenital cataracts.
Some experts consider the optimal time to intervene and remove a visually significant congenital cataract to be between 6 weeks and 3 months of age.
If your baby has a congenital cataract, discuss any concerns you have about the timing of cataract surgery with your paediatric ophthalmologist.
Once the cataract has been removed, it is absolutely essential to correct your child’s vision with a surgically implanted intraocular lens (IOL), a contact lens or glasses. Without vision correction after cataract surgery, the eye will see poorly and the normal development of the infant’s vision will be affected.
Opinions also differ on whether an artificial lens should be surgically implanted in a baby’s eye after cataract surgery, owing to concerns that it may affect the eye’s normal development, and to the possibility of complications. An intraocular lens may also need to be removed and replaced as your child grows, because of changes in vision.
In some cases, contact lenses worn on the surface of the eye (the cornea) can help restore vision after the natural lens has been removed during cataract surgery. Glasses may also be prescribed instead of an implanted artificial lens or contact lenses.

Congenital cataracts and other vision problems
Without timely intervention, congenital cataracts cause amblyopia (lazy eye). This can in turn lead to other eye problems, such as nystagmus, strabismus and an inability to fix on objects.
Such problems can profoundly affect a child’s learning, personality and even appearance — and ultimately their whole life. For these and many other reasons, make sure your child has a routine eye examination at 6 months of age, again at three years, and once more before starting school.
